var errMissingOID = errors.New("object ID is not set")
var (
errMissingOID = errors.New("object ID is not set")
errInvalidTargetType = errors.New("bearer token defines non-container target override")
errBearerExpired = errors.New("bearer token has expired")
errBearerInvalidSignature = errors.New("bearer token has invalid signature")
errBearerInvalidContainerID = errors.New("bearer token was created for another container")
errBearerNotSignedByOwner = errors.New("bearer token is not signed by the container owner")
errBearerInvalidOwner = errors.New("bearer token owner differs from the request sender")
)
// isValidBearer checks whether bearer token was correctly signed by authorized
// entity. This method might be defined on whole ACL service because it will
// require fetching current epoch to check lifetime.
func isValidBearer(token *bearer.Token, ownerCnr user.ID, containerID cid.ID, publicKey *keys.PublicKey, st netmap.State) error {
if token == nil {
return nil
}
// 1. First check token lifetime. Simplest verification.
if token.InvalidAt(st.CurrentEpoch()) {
return errBearerExpired
}
// 2. Then check if bearer token is signed correctly.
if !token.VerifySignature() {
return errBearerInvalidSignature
}
// 3. Then check if container is either empty or equal to the container in the request.
apeOverride := token.APEOverride()
if apeOverride.Target.TargetType != ape.TargetTypeContainer {
return errInvalidTargetType
}
var targetCnr cid.ID
err := targetCnr.DecodeString(apeOverride.Target.Name)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("invalid cid format: %s", apeOverride.Target.Name)
}
if !containerID.Equals(targetCnr) {
return errBearerInvalidContainerID
}
// 4. Then check if container owner signed this token.
if !bearer.ResolveIssuer(*token).Equals(ownerCnr) {
return errBearerNotSignedByOwner
}
// 5. Then check if request sender has rights to use this token.
var usrSender user.ID
user.IDFromKey(&usrSender, (ecdsa.PublicKey)(*publicKey))
if !token.AssertUser(usrSender) {
return errBearerInvalidOwner
}
return nil
}
